Severn Trent Systems to OEM Broadbeam
Corporation's ExpressQ as Part of Its Worksuite Mobile Solution for
Utilities
PRINCETON, N.J., January 3, 2001 /PRNewswire/ - Broadbeam
Corporation, a leading wireless infrastructure provider, and Severn
Trent Systems (STS) today announced that the two companies have
signed a partnering agreement.
The agreement enables STS to resell Broadbeam's ExpressQ wireless
application server as part of its Worksuite mobile solutions to
its utility industry customers worldwide. This partnership strengthens
Broadbeam's global position in the utility market.
Severn Trent Systems is a software products and services organization
dedicated to providing enterprise to desktop solutions to the electric,
gas, water, communications and petroleum industries worldwide. The
Work Management Systems Business Unit of STS provides Worksuite,
a complete suite of integrated work force management products that
connect the office and field users of utility companies. Its range
of products includes Field IT™, a web-based product family that
enables field-based employees to make real-time use of data found
within office-based applications.
ExpressQ, part of Broadbeam's Wireless Platform, is a wireless
application server that extends enterprise applications to mobile
workers providing push and guaranteed message delivery, message
queuing, security and more, in a fully scalable platform that integrates
easily into enterprise systems.
The agreement builds upon the successes of several customers, among
the largest of their type that are deploying Worksuite mobile solutions
from Severn Trent, including NTL and Severn Trent Water in the United
Kingdom, and PREPA, the PuertoRico Electric Power Authority.

About Severn Trent Systems
Severn Trent Systems (STS) is a software products and services organization
dedicated to helping utility clients achieve higher levels of operational
efficiency and customer service through the use of customer information,
work management, engineering analysis and marketing information
solutions. STS solutions are used by the electric, natural gas,
water and petroleum industries worldwide. STS provides customer
relationship management, work and asset management, field systems
software and a full range of related professional services. Through
Stoner Associates, STS also provides off-line network modeling and
on-line, real-time pipeline simulation software and a full range
of related professional and consulting services. Severn Trent Systems,
with offices in Birmingham (UK), Carlisle (PA), Gieres (FR), Houston
(TX), Phoenix (AZ), Charlotte (NC), Sydney (AU), Melbourne (AU)
and Swindon (UK), is part of Severn Trent Plc.
